==List of works== ===Published by the composer=== * ''[[Polyeucte (Dukas)|Polyeucte]]'', overture for orchestra (1891) * [[Symphony in C (Dukas)|Symphony in C]] (1895–96) * ''[[The Sorcerer's Apprentice (Dukas)|The Sorcerer's Apprentice]]'', for orchestra (1897) * [[Piano Sonata (Dukas)|Piano Sonata in E-flat minor]] (1899–1900) * ''[[Variations, Interlude and Finale on a Theme by Rameau]]'', for piano (c.1899–1902) * ''[[Ariane et Barbe-bleue]]'', opera (1899–1907) * ''Villanelle'', for horn and piano (1906) * ''Prélude élégiaque sur le nom de Haydn'', for piano (1909) * ''Vocalise-étude (alla gitana)'', for voice and piano (1909) * ''[[La Péri (Dukas)|La Péri]]'', ballet (poème dansé) (1911; later supplemented with ''Fanfare pour précéder La Péri'' (1912)) * ''La plainte, au loin, du faune...'', for piano (1920) * ''Amours'', sonnet for voice and piano (1924) * ''Allegro'', for piano (1925) * ''Modéré'', for piano (?) (1933; published posthumously in 1936) ===Early unpublished works=== * ''Air de Clytemnestre'', for voice and small orchestra (1882) * ''Goetz de Berlichingen'', overture for orchestra (1883) * ''Le roi Lear'', for orchestra (1883) * ''Chanson de Barberine'', for soprano and orchestra (1884) * ''La fête des Myrthes'', for choir and orchestra (1884) * ''L'ondine et le pêcheur'', for soprano and orchestra (1884) * ''Endymion'', cantata for three solo voices and orchestra (1885) * ''Introduction au poème "Les Caresses"'', for piano (1885) * ''La vision de Saül'', cantata for three solo voices and orchestra (1886) * ''La fleur'', for choir and orchestra (1887) * Fugue (1888) * ''Hymne au soleil'', for choir and orchestra (1888) * ''Velléda'', cantata for three solo voices and orchestra (1888) * ''Sémélé'', cantata for three solo voices and orchestra (1889) ===Destroyed and projected works=== * ''Horn et Riemenhild'', opera (1892) * ''L'arbre de science'', opera (1899) * ''Le fil de parque'', symphonic poem (c.1908) * ''Le nouveau monde'', opera (c.1908–1910) * ''Le sang de Méduse'', ballet (1912) * Symphony No. 2 (after 1912) * Violin Sonata (after 1912) * ''La tempête'', opera (c.1918) * ''Variations choréographiques'', ballet (1930) * An untitled orchestral work for Boston Symphonic Orchestra (1932)
